Ihavandhoo “Hiythakuge Noor” Program: Winners Awarded Cash Prizes and Gifts

The Women’s Development Committee (WDC) of Haa Alifu Ihavandhoo has presented cash checks and gifts to recognize the children who achieved top ranks in the second round of the Quran memorization program for children. The program, named “Noor of Hearts” (Hiththakuge Noor), began in March of this year and is structured in three rounds. In each round, students who successfully recite the designated portion of the Quran from memory within the specified period are awarded a cash prize. In this program, students who completed the first round were presented with a gift and MVR 500.00 (five hundred Rufiyaa) by the committee. Furthermore, students who qualified for and completed the second round were given a gift along with MVR 700.00 (seven hundred Rufiyaa). In addition, the Ihavandhoo WDC has decided to award a cash prize of MVR 1,000.00 (one thousand Rufiyaa) to those who complete the third round of the competition. The Ihavandhoo Council and the Women’s Development Committee are working to foster a love for the Holy Quran in Ihavandhoo, promote the art of Quranic recitation, and produce high-quality students capable of reciting the Quran at a national level.
